> > ret = devm_add_action_or_reset(dev, clk_put, port->clk)
> >
> The second argument of devm_add_action_or_reset() is of type void (*)(void *)
> and the argument of clk_put() is of type struct clk *, so I think a cast is
> needed:
>
> ret = devm_add_action_or_reset(dev, (void (*)(void *)) clk_put, port->clk)
Can you use devm_get_clk_from_child() here? If not add a similar variant.
